<p><strong>Why an accent wall?<br />
</strong>Painting a single wall in your apartment in a complementary, yet distinct, color can create a powerful decor statement. You can jazz up a plain floor plan and draw the eye through the apartment space, perhaps away from weak points or unglamorous views. An accent wall can also create a sense of depth in an area like a hallway or staircase.</p>
<p>Adding an accent wall is a great way to tip-toe into a whole-apartment color change. Painting just one wall gives you a chance to test-drive a color before committing that change to a larger space. It’s an effective way of getting color into your home on a shoestring budget.</p>
<p><strong>Don’t pick a random color<br />
</strong>Just because orange is your favorite color doesn’t mean it’s going to work for an accent wall. Look around your apartment, and you’ll see that there is likely a color scheme you may or may not have consciously created. Choosing a color that is totally outside that palette may create more discord than harmony in your interior design. Then again, with a careful eye, you may discover an unusual color choice is just the right touch for a certain space. Consider visual texture, as well. A stucco technique is a unique approach for an accent wall that can set up a visually-arresting scene.</p>
<p><strong><a href="http://www.apartmentguide.com/blog/color-dos-and-donts-for-creating-an-accent-wall/agblog-story-verticalcoloraccentwall/" rel="attachment wp-att-56211"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-56211" alt="Color Do's and Don'ts for Creating an Accent Wall" src="http://www.apartmentguide.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2013/04/agblog.story_.verticalcoloraccentwall.jpg" width="219" height="365" /></a>Do work with your decor<br />
</strong>Creating a decor punch doesn’t have to involve a color that screams at you every time you pass by. That said, if you like bold colors, an accent wall can be the place for one. You can use the wall to set off a featured piece of furniture, a striking window treatment, or even the carpet, for instance.</p>
<p>Maybe you’re working with pre-existing colors in your countertop, carpet or wallpaper that you’d like either to counteract or integrate into your apartment’s color scheme. Selecting the right accent wall color can make those unchangeable parts of your decor finally work together &#8212; without having to repaint the entire room!</p>
<p><strong>Don’t go too light<br />
</strong>Remember that “accent” in this case means an attention-getting color. If you choose a shade that is too pastel or neutral, it will be hard to tell that your accent wall is set off from the rest of your wall colors. Go vivid, saturated or simply bright, but make sure that single wall stands out from the rest.</p>
<p><strong>Don’t burden your wall<br />
</strong>An accent wall can make a statement in itself, so choose a color that you want to really look at, uncovered and empty. If you decide to hang things on the wall, make them spare and simple. Too much art on an accent wall can make the room feel out of balance, and the wall cluttered.</p>
<p><strong>Do check your lease</strong><br />
Don’t assume that just because you’re happy to repaint the accent wall its original color when you leave your apartment means that your landlord is okay with your decorating plans. Read your lease for any specific language about making changes to your apartment. If you have any doubts, contact your landlord or management company directly to make sure you can paint before you begin.</p>

<p><strong>Natural light<br />
</strong>To figure out the natural light you have, turn off all the lights in your apartment and walk through it — in daylight, of course. Pay close attention to which windows let sunlight in. To increase your available light naturally, be sure not to block any of these windows with heavy draperies or shades.</p>
<p>Venetian-style blinds can actually help you direct the sunlight where you’d like it to fall. Redirecting the sunlight to the ceiling, for instance, moves light further into a room. Placing a mirror across from bright windows will also help amplify sunlight, as well. Besides funneling sunlight where you want it, blinds are also great for maintaining privacy.</p>
<p><strong>Echoing the sunlight<br />
</strong>Supplementing the sunlight with the right lamp is a great way to extend what you get naturally. A <a href="http://www.lamps.com/dale-tiffany-tr90210-tiffany-torchiere-lamp.html" target="_blank">torchiere floor lamp</a> placed in the back part of a room that receives some daylight can seamlessly fill in where the natural light falls off.</p>
<p>You might look for a lamp with a natural motif, one that reminds you of the sun outside. This <a href="http://www.lamps.com/dale-tiffany-tt101259-5-light-sunflower-table-lamp.html" target="_blank">sunflower lamp</a> is a great device to brighten your room and your mood.</p>
<p><strong>Finding the right lighting style<br />
</strong>Is your apartment decor <a href="http://www.inmod.com/lights-up-5-arm-chandelier-clip.html" target="_blank">modern</a>? <a href="http://www.pier1.com/Hayworth-Rosette-Lamp/2514985,default,pd.html?cgid=lighting" target="_blank">Romantic</a>? <a href="http://www.lampsplus.com/products/ivory-sailboat-table-lamp__69549.html" target="_blank">Coastal</a>? <a href="http://www.inmod.com/lights-up-soiree-floor-lamp-antique-bronze-finish.html" target="_blank">Artistic</a>?</p>
<p>Whatever your favorite flair, your lighting can help reinforce it. Track lighting is a great addition to a loft or other urban space, as are <a href="http://www.ikea.com/us/en/catalog/products/10180977" target="_blank">metallic lamps</a>. Fabric shades can be cozy, elegant or streamlined, depending on their color or shape. Choose the vibe you wish to create in your apartment home, and pick lamps to complement your style.</p>
<p><strong>Lighten with color<br />
</strong>Another effective way to create a bright space is to paint walls in light colors &#8212; with your landlord’s approval, of course. White brightens instantly, as do light shades of yellow, pink or green.</p>
<p>Lighter shades for linens help brighten an apartment space, as well. And don’t underestimate the difference that light-stained furniture will make to enlighten a room.</p>
<p><strong>Don’t be afraid of the dark<br />
</strong>One caveat in the effort to banish shadows from your apartment is that, in some cases, dim light can be your friend. If you have a wall of photographs, for instance, or a piece of fine art, you’ll want to protect those items from direct sunlight to maintain their quality.</p>
<p>You might also have a space devoted to a quiet pursuit, such as a favorite <a href="http://www.zgallerie.com/p-8748-enzo-floor-lamp-chrome.aspx" target="_blank">place to read</a> or an office <a href="http://www.zgallerie.com/p-11880-charleston-desk-lamp.aspx" target="_blank">desk</a> with powerful lighting of its own. In such cases, darkened corners can enforce a sense of cozy focus. A little bit of ambient light, in the form of a small, <a href="http://www.lightinguniverse.com/table-lamps/kenroy-home-03332-wright-table-lamp-oil-rubbed-bronze_g214375.html?isku=1813139&amp;linkloc=cataLogProductItemsImage" target="_blank">decorative table lamp</a>, is all you need to supplement lighting in these cases.</p>

<p><strong>Cabinet Couture</strong><br />
Perhaps nothing takes more abuse in your kitchen than your <a href="http://www.apartmentguide.com/blog/organize-your-kitchen-cabinets/" target="_blank">cabinets</a>. All it takes is a fresh coat of paint to make them like new again. Update your kitchen’s look just by removing the cabinet doors and repainting them. For easy-to-reach cabinets, create additional functionality by painting one of the doors with chalkboard or dry erase board paint, turning it into a handy space for jotting notes and grocery lists. Change out the handles and hinges to something more modern, or add a touch of vintage charm. Stores like Anthropologie offer <a href="http://www.anthropologie.com/anthro/category/knobs,%20hooks%20&amp;%20more/home-hardware.jsp" target="_blank">drawer pulls and knobs</a> of all shapes, sizes and price points, so pick a decor style and experiment.</p>
<p><span id="more-36949"></span></p>
<p><strong>Freshen Up Those Kicks</strong><br />
If you have a worn, dirty pair of sneakers lying around, don’t toss them in the garbage; give them a makeover. Bleach and a toothbrush will make the whitewalls look like new. Replace the laces and insoles if needed. If the exterior soles are hanging open and flopping around, super glue or an automotive adhesive will put them in their place.</p>

<p><strong>Love Your Loveseat</strong><br />
For an inexpensive update, consider decking out your outdated sofa with a <a href="http://www.realsimple.com/home-organizing/decorating/tips-techniques/find-right-slipcovers-sofa-10000001665749/index.html" target="_blank">vibrant slipcover</a>. Adding a few <a href="http://www.apartmentguide.com/blog/six-fun-and-funky-throw-pillows/" target="_blank">decorative throw pillows</a> can breathe new life into an <a href="http://www.apartmentguide.com/blog/mix-match-modern-and-vintage-decor/" target="_blank">old chair or loveseat</a>. You might be surprised how this simple DIY fix can create a whole new look for your room.</p>
<p><strong>Deal With Baggage</strong><br />
Our luggage gets a lot of wear and tear from moving, vacationing and business travel, so it’s good to give suitcases and travel bags some attention once in a while. Torn exteriors can be glued down with vinyl cement (for vinyl luggage) or fabric glue (for fabric luggage). Loose interior linings can be glued back with fabric glue. For leather luggage, use rubber cement or a vinyl acetate adhesive. Scuffed leather can be buffed out using a matching leather polish. Even the <a href="http://traveltips.usatoday.com/repair-wheels-luggage-62512.html" target="_blank">wheels can be repaired</a> with a little ingenuity.</p>

<p><b>Calendars and Maps.</b> Sure, maps are kind of old hat now that you&#8217;ve got that spiffy new GPS with turn-by-turn directions, but there&#8217;s no need to throw them out. Cut out an interesting stretch of land from your travels, frame it, and you&#8217;ve got instant art. The same thing goes for last year&#8217;s art calendar. Those iconic images you admired for just one-twelfth of the year can now be enjoyed year-round.</p>

<p><b>T-shirts and Sweaters.</b> With a little stuffing and some thread, those old items of clothing can become attractive and cozy throw pillows.</p>
<p><b>Doors.</b> Old doors salvaged from demolished houses or barns can find new life throughout your home as decorative yet functional pieces and accents. Turn a barn door into a dining room table. Turn an old door into a headboard for your bed. Hinge three doors together, give them a splashy coat of paint and use them as a privacy screen. The sky&#8217;s the limit!</p>
<p><b>Older Fixtures.</b> Even fixtures from an older house—or your old house—can find new life in your new abode, and many can be found cheaply. Turn decorative ceiling tiles from an old building into a kitchen backsplash. Replace your dingy plastic tub with an old claw foot model. Replace handles, hinges and drawer pulls with their older, more rustic counterparts.</p>
<p><b>Containers.</b> You never know when an old vase, flower pot or umbrella stand might come in handy as an indoor planter or other conversation piece. Sometimes all it needs is a good scrubbing and a little spray paint to become something brand new.</p>

<p>The parts of your city’s personality which you choose to bring indoors can give your apartment a look unlike any other. Find aspects of your new city or a favorite city to inspire your décor, whether it involves culture, history, climate or geography. Pulling together the details that stand out to you will make you feel closer to the places you cherish and pay homage to.</p>
<p><strong>Identify local high points</strong><br />
Consider for a moment: what is the essence of where you live? Is your town defined by its location near the ocean, mountains or desert? Or maybe your city has an urban personality all its own, something like San Francisco&#8217;s bohemianism, Los Angeles&#8217; luxury, Miami&#8217;s modernism or Charleston&#8217;s history. </p>
<p>Perhaps your district defines how you feel about living in your apartment. From Chinatown to the French Quarter, most cities offer a number of different atmospheres, depending on the part of town you’re in. To immerse yourself in those vibes, pick out what you feel are the most essential aspects of your hometown. </p>
<p><strong>Your apartment as a stage</strong><br />
Now for the fun! Once you’ve chosen your city inspiration, it’s time to begin collecting your décor items. Here’s where your personal style and imagination can shine as you set the scene. Consider:</p>
<p>•	<a href="http://www.cafepress.com/+city-map+framed-prints" target="_blank">Framed maps</a> of favorite cities or neighborhoods</p>
<p>•	<a href="http://www.wall-art.com/Wall-Stickers/CitiesCountries/Landmarks/" target="_blank">Wall art</a> that captures an iconic scene from the city</p>
<p>•	Wall maps of the entire city</p>
<p>•	Personal souvenirs, like metro tickets, menus, museum brochures or photographs</p>
<p>•	<a href="http://www.amazon.com/Bronze-Eiffel-Figurine-Isolated-Backgrou/dp/B005JWU60I" target="_blank">Small statues,</a> travel posters or whatever brings the city vibe into your apartment</p>
<p>You can be as original as your creativity allows. Collect fishing nets for your Maine apartment or theater posters for your Broadway bailiwick. The little details can go a long way to create your ideal city atmosphere.</p>
<p><strong>Color your city</strong><br />
One dramatic way to underscore your city vibe is with color. Blue and white create the nautical atmosphere of Capri as easily as Catalina. Vivid reds and yellows can recall a European bistro, and black and white on chrome help create your ‘any city’ — a powerful backdrop to whatever town you’d like to emphasize with your unique décor items.  </p>
<p><strong>Pieces of your place</strong><br />
Gathering key furniture pieces that share city inspiration can give substance to your décor plan. Whether you find some Adirondack chairs for your Catskills-style retreat, remnants from an old textile mill for your Burlington apartment, or a sleek drafting table for your Silicon Valley digs, look for furniture items that represent your city’s past or present. </p>
<p><strong>Embrace the exotic</strong><br />
Maybe your favorite city isn’t the one you live in, but, rather, a place you’ve lived before or that simply inspires you. Do you yearn for Budapest, Boston or Barcelona? Bring a piece of those places home. By collecting materials that harken to your favorite spot, you can create the atmosphere you love, though you may be thousands of miles away. </p>

<p><strong>Cheese Grater </strong><br />
Sounds strange, doesn’t it? This one is rather simple, but it’s an easy and unique way to display your earrings. You can make it your own by spray painting the grater with a color that goes well with your décor. First, spray paint the grater with a primer. Once it is completely dry, cover the grater with a color of spray paint that you like. Let that coat dry, and if needed, add an additional coat of spray paint. Use the holes to display your earrings.</p>

<p><strong>Branch</strong><br />
This one is simple, and you can use supplies you may already have around your apartment. First, head outdoors and search for a small branch. Next, hammer smaller nails into the branch on the same side. To attach to your wall, hammer two larger, stronger nails into the wall, and prop the branch on the nails. Next, hang your necklaces from the nails on the branch.</p>
<p><strong>Rake </strong><br />
To continue the theme of repurposing old items, enter the garden rake. Living in an apartment means not having to worry about raking leaves in the fall. So repurpose that old rake and turn it into a jewelry holder. Take a head of an old rake and clean it off. If you’re feeling spontaneous, prime and spray paint the rake to match your décor. Next, tie jute twine around the top part of the rake for extra earring storage. Mount the rake head with a screw onto the door of your closet or on the wall. Use this to hang your necklaces.</p>
<p><strong>Knobs </strong><br />
Craft stores, antique markets and stores like Anthropologie all have collections of old door knobs, drawer knobs and drawer pulls. Install small knobs on the wall to hang your necklaces and bracelets. Select three or five different knobs that go with your décor to display your jewelry. Drawer pulls are perfect for rings and earrings.</p>
<p><strong>Picture Frames </strong><br />
You have several options to display your jewelry using picture frames. One way to display your earrings is to attach picture wire to the back of a frame. Use an old frame, if possible, and repaint it with acrylic or spray paint.  Attach picture hanging wire to the back of the frame with a staple gun. If you don’t have a staple gun, use small thumb tacks. Repeat this step several times until your frame is filled up. Space the rows about 2.25 inches apart. Place this on top of a dresser, chest of drawers or your bathroom counter.</p>
<p>Another option is to attach a peg board to the frame. Prime and spray the picture frame to match your décor. Next, attach a peg board to the inside of the frame with Gorilla glue, and apply some weight. If you want the peg board to be a different color, paint it before attaching it to the frame. Then, attach small accessories to the peg board, such as baskets and hangers. The baskets are useful for rings, bracelets and stud earrings. Use the hangers to display your necklaces.</p>
